Hello all,

I got my brakes done a month ago. I went with the fronts first, then the rears. After i got the rears done i started to notice a rotational squeak coming from the rear brakes. When i apply the brakes the noise pitches then goes away as the pads come in contact with the rotors. I brought it back to my mechanic and he took them apart, cleaned them up and put it back together. The noise was gone until about an hour later. What could this be? could the pads just need to wear in? it's starting to drive me nuts, any ideas for a resolution are welcome, thanks!

Are the pistons "clocked" right....the little pin in the pad needs to set into the groove of the caliper when everything is in position or it let's the pads sit slightly crooked. That was the problem mine had. Turned the pistons to line up no more squeak
